What is an Ergometer?

Every boathouse in Canada has a row of them along one wall. Concept2 RowErgs - the indoor rowing machines that translate each stroke into watts, splits and metres on the PM5 screen up front. When freeze-up locks the lake from November through April, the erg is not a complement to on-water work. It is the work. OUA programmes run their selection trials on it, CSSRA athletes benchmark to it before Brentwood, and the Canadian Indoor Rowing Championships exist because of it.

Ergometer, erg, indoor rower: same thing

Three names cover one piece of equipment. The technical one is "ergometer", borrowed from Greek ergon (work) and used in coach education through the NCCP, in sports science journals, and in the Rowing Canada Aviron testing manual. The casual one is "erg" - what anyone who has rowed in a Canadian boathouse actually says: "60 minutes on the erg," "her 2k erg is 6:48," "the ergs are booked solid at five." The fitness-industry name is "indoor rower" or "rowing machine", which is how it appears on a Costco price tag. All three refer to the same kit: a sliding seat on a rail, a footplate with adjustable straps, a chain-mounted handle, and a flywheel that resists the pull.

How an ergometer works

Each stroke pulls the chain, which spins the flywheel. The flywheel resists through air (Concept2), water (WaterRower), magnets (Hydrow), or some blend of the three. Sensors inside the housing time how quickly the flywheel decelerates between strokes, run the work-done calculation, and convert the answer into metres rowed. Everything the PM5 displays - split, watts, calories, distance - falls out of that single deceleration measurement happening hundreds of times per second.

On a Concept2, the lever on the side of the flywheel cage is the damper. It runs from 1 (light, snappy acceleration) to 10 (heavy, slow acceleration) and changes how each stroke feels. It does not change the score. The number that actually matters for performance is drag factor, calculated by the monitor under More Options and adjusted automatically for damper position and the air density in the room. Most Canadian boathouses run cold and dry through winter, which pulls drag factor higher at the same damper setting than a humid summer afternoon would. The Concept2 standard

The Concept2 RowErg (previously sold as Model D and Model E) has dominated Canadian rowing since the mid-1980s. It is the machine used at the World Rowing Indoor Championships, the Canadian Indoor Rowing Championships (CIRC), every Rowing Canada Aviron and provincial selection trial, and at every U Sports varsity programme from McGill to UBC. What gives it that position is design longevity. The flywheel, chain, monorail, handle, footplate and damper have stayed essentially identical for decades, and the calibration is consistent enough that a 2k score from 2008 compares cleanly against a 2k score from 2026. That continuity is why coaches can compare a fresher across years and why university recruiters can read a high-school score from anywhere in Canada without asking for context.

WaterRower, Hydrow, NordicTrack and Echelon build machines for the home fitness market. None of them calibrate to the Concept2 standard. A 2k personal best on a WaterRower is not directly comparable to a 2k on a RowErg, and Canadian club coaches, OUA selection panels and Rowing Canada Aviron testing administrators will only accept Concept2 scores when it counts. If you want a score that travels, the machine has to be a Concept2.

What the readouts mean

  • 500m split: the time the monitor projects to cover the next 500 metres at the current rate of work. A 1:45 split means the next half-kilometre would land in 1 minute 45 seconds. This is the primary pacing metric in Canadian rowing and the number coaches write on the whiteboard.
  • Watts: instantaneous power output. The Concept2 formula is watts = 2.80 / (split_seconds / 500)^3. A 1:45 split produces roughly 268 watts; a 1:30 split produces roughly 425 watts. The cubic term is what makes the climb hurt.
  • Calories per hour: approximately watts x 4 plus 300 for basal metabolism. Useful as a session-to-session training-load proxy. Not a dietitian-grade fuelling figure.
  • Stroke rate: strokes per minute. UT2 (low aerobic) sits at 18 to 20, UT1 at 20 to 24, anaerobic threshold at 26 to 28, race pace climbs from 32 to 38.
  • Distance: metres of work calculated from flywheel deceleration. Not literal distance. The machine is not moving.

How Canadian rowing clubs use ergometers

Canadian clubs lean on the erg harder than clubs in milder climates because the calendar forces it. Across Ontario and Quebec the river is unrowable from late November through early April. In the prairies the season is shorter still. Even on the south coast of Vancouver Island, where Elk Lake and the Gorge stay open through most of the winter, ergs carry the morning trials. So the erg is not a winter substitute - it is the platform that holds the OUA fall trial block, the winter Royal Canadian Henley build, and the spring sprint preparation together. It gives coaches a controlled environment for the standard fitness tests (2k, 5k, 6k, 30 minute, 60 minute), and it feeds crew selection alongside seat-racing and on-water timed pieces.

Erg scores belong in the squad management system next to on-water data, body weight, attendance and injury notes. Recording every test against the right athlete, plotting the trajectory across a season, and comparing against age-adjusted and weight-adjusted standards is what makes selection decisions defensible when a 1st VIII seat comes down to two athletes. Erg testing protocols

Standard ergometer test pieces used across Canadian competitive rowing:

  • 2,000m (2k): the headline fitness test, matching the Olympic race distance. Maximum effort. Elite men land between 5:40 and 6:00; elite women between 6:30 and 7:00; competitive OUA and CSSRA 1st VIII rowers between 6:15 and 6:45.
  • 5,000m (5k): aerobic capacity test. 17 to 19 minutes for competitive senior men, 19 to 21 minutes for senior women, longer for juniors and masters.
  • 30 minutes: distance covered at sustained anaerobic threshold pace. Standard winter benchmark for tracking aerobic base across the long Canadian off-season.
  • 60 minutes: the long aerobic test, typically rowed at UT1 or UT2 pace. Common in November and December training blocks at university programmes.
  • 4 x 2,000m or 8 x 500m intervals: race-specific power and recovery testing. The 8 x 500m piece is the standard sharpening session in the final weeks before a 2k trial.

Each test gets logged with the rower's body weight on the day (lighter rowers carry a power-to-weight disadvantage that the World Rowing weight-adjusted formula corrects) and the drag factor used. Without the drag factor and weight in the record, a score is hard to compare against itself.

Indoor rowing as a sport in its own right

Indoor rowing has grown into a discipline of its own, no longer just a training tool for on-water athletes. The C.R.A.S.H.-B Sprints in Boston (running since 1982) is the original international indoor 2k championship and Canadian crews travel south for it every February. The Canadian Indoor Rowing Championships (CIRC), the World Rowing Indoor Championships, and Concept2's annual online challenges - Holiday Challenge in December, Fall Team Challenge, the Million Metre badge - fill the calendar with events that need no water and no boat. CrossFit gyms and commercial fitness clubs across Canada run their own erg leagues, pulling in participants who would never set foot in a boathouse.

Ergometer FAQs

Is an ergometer the same as a rowing machine?

Yes. In Canadian rowing, 'ergometer' (or the shorter 'erg') is the technical and the everyday term for what most commercial gyms label a rowing machine. The two words refer to the same equipment. Competitive rowers use 'erg' almost without exception. The wider fitness market uses 'rowing machine'. The dominant make at every Canadian rowing club, every U Sports varsity programme, and every Rowing Canada Aviron testing centre is the Concept2 RowErg, and has been since the mid-1980s. It is also the machine used at every world championship indoor rowing event.

What does an ergometer measure?

It measures the mechanical work done on each stroke and converts that into a set of readouts on the monitor: 500m split (the projected pace for the next half-kilometre at the current rate of work), watts (instantaneous power output), calories per hour, distance covered, elapsed time and stroke rate. Concept2 ties split to power through the formula watts = 2.80 / (split_seconds / 500)^3. The calorie figure is approximately watts x 4 plus 300 for basal metabolism. Every reading on the PM5 falls out of timing how fast the flywheel decelerates between strokes, and the whole session writes itself to the Concept2 Logbook automatically.

What is a good 2k erg time?

For senior men at a competitive Canadian club, sub-7:00 (1:45 split or quicker) is the working target, with sub-6:30 (1:37 split) indicating national-level fitness. For senior women, sub-8:00 (2:00 split) is the working target and sub-7:15 (1:48 split) is the national-level mark. U19 athletes typically aim for 6:30 to 7:00 (boys) and 7:30 to 8:00 (girls). OUA and CSSRA 1st VIII athletes usually sit between 6:15 and 6:45 by championship week. Masters rowers should always run the raw score through the Concept2 age-grading tables before drawing comparisons against the open figures. How does the erg measure distance without moving?

The flywheel does the work. Each stroke pulls the chain, the chain spins the flywheel, and the flywheel meets resistance from air drawn in through the cage. Sensors inside the housing time how quickly the flywheel slows down between strokes. From that single measurement the monitor calculates the work done per stroke and converts it into 'metres rowed', expressed as if the rower were propelling a boat. The drag factor lets the monitor compensate for damper position and the air density in the room, which is how a January session in a cold Toronto boathouse compares fairly against an August session in a humid Halifax shed. The metres displayed are not literal distance - they are a standardised unit of work output dressed up in metres.

What damper setting should I use on an erg?

Most Canadian rowers train at damper 3 to 5 on a Concept2, not 10. The damper changes how the stroke feels (5 feels like a heavier boat, 1 feels like a fast racing single) but has no direct effect on the score. The number that actually governs the work done is drag factor, displayed under More Options on the PM5. Lightweight men typically aim for drag factor 110 to 130. Heavyweight men sit at 130 to 150. Lightweight women run 105 to 120 and heavyweight women 120 to 135. World Indoor Rowing Championships events are generally rowed at drag factors below 130. Pick a drag factor and stick to it across the season so scores compare cleanly to one another.

Can ergometer scores predict on-water speed?

Yes, with caveats. The erg measures raw power output in a controlled, weather-free environment. On-water speed is power plus technique plus boat balance plus crew timing plus water conditions plus steering. A faster erg score does generally indicate a faster rower in the boat, but the relationship is not one-to-one. Rowing Canada Aviron selection panels and OUA coaches use erg numbers as one input alongside seat-racing, on-water timed pieces and direct coach assessment. Watch for rowers who post strong erg scores but cannot transfer the power to the boat - and watch equally for rowers who underperform on the erg but rise to the top in seat-racing on Henley Island.
